Methane clathrate deposits in the ocean floor have been found to be inhabited by polychaete worms of the species Hesiocaeca methanicola. The worms colonize the methane ice and appear to survive by gleaning bacteria which in turn metabolize the clathrate.In 1997, Charles Fisher, professor of biology at Pennsylvania State University, discovered the worm living on mounds of methane ice at a depth of half a mile (~800 m) on the ocean floor in the Gulf of Mexico.
